a) A Master’s Degree (Level 7 Malaysian Qualifications Framework, MQF| or equivalent and candidates must have completed at least one (1) of their earlier Degree (Master’s or Bachelor’s) in Computing or related to computing. OR b) A Bachelor’s Degree (Level 6 Malaysian Qualifications Framework, MQF) with the following conditions:
- A Bachelor’s Degree (Level 6 Malaysian Qualifications Framework, MQF) in the field or related fields with first-class (CGPA of 3.67 or higher) or its equivalent from an academic or Technical and Vocational Education and Training (TVET) programme;
- Undergo internal assessment;
- Any other requirements of the HEP. OR
c) A Bachelor’s Degree (Level 6 Malaysian Qualifications Framework, MQF) candidates who are registered for Master’s Degree programmes may apply to convert to the Doctoral Degree programmes subjected to the following conditions:
- Within 1 vear for full time and within 2 years for part-time candidates:
- Having shown competency and capability in conducting research at Doctoral level through rigorous internal evaluation by the HEP; and
- Approval of the HEP Senate. OR
d) Other qualifications equivalent to a Master Degree (Level 7 Malaysian Qualifications Framework, MQF) in the field or related fields recognised by the HEP Senate.
International students must have proof of good proficiency in verbal and written English.
1. Obtain Test of English as a Foreign Language (TOEFL iBT) score of 60 or
2. International English Language Testing System (IELTS) score of 6.0 or its equivalent
Duration
- Full time – Minimum 3 years, Maximum 8 years
- Part Time – Minimum 5 years, Maximum 10 years
